GRIFFITH
Linda Lois Griffith, 68, of White Sulphur Springs, passed away on September 24, 2022, at her home after a long and courageous battle with cancer.
She was born September 20, 1954, in White Sulphur Springs and was the daughter of the late Baxter Curtis and Lucille Allen Griffith.
Linda was a 1973 graduate of Greenbrier East High School and was employed at the Greenbrier Hotel for 27 years in the salad pantry. She also was the manager and supervisor at Larry’s Deer Processing for 23 years during deer season. Linda always loved the outdoors, campfires, fishing, and playing with her dogs, especially Spicy.
She was raised in the Pentecostal Holiness Church.
Linda was also preceded in death by brothers, Wayne, Bernard, Harvey, and James; and her sisters, Donna Louise and Marguerite Ann Griffith.
Surviving include her loving daughter, Jessica Dawn White; two sisters, Betty Craft and Sandra Griffith, both of White Sulphur Springs; two brothers, Larry Griffith (her twin) and Baxter Griffith, both of White Sulphur Springs; and a host of nephews, nieces, and cousins. Her best friend and father of Jessica, Bob White of White Sulphur Springs.
Linda’s final wishes were to have her body donated to Medical Sciences at WVSOM Human Gift Registry; her request has been honored by her daughter.
